Understanding a domain name
Domain name
A domain name is the address used to access a website or service on the Internet, for example monsite.fr.
It makes it possible to use an easy-to-remember name instead of an IP address made up of numbers or technical characters.
A domain name can be used for a website, e-mail addresses, or other online services.
Extension
The extension is the part at the end of the domain name.
In monsite.fr, the extension is .fr.

ccTLD
A ccTLD is an extension mainly associated with a country or territory.
For example:
.fr for [ADDRESS] ;
.be for [ADDRESS] ;
.de for Germany ;
.es for Spain.
Registration rules can vary from one extension to another.

IDN
An IDN, for Internationalized Domain Name, is a domain name that can contain characters that are not part [PERSON_NAME] the classic Latin alphabet.
[PERSON_NAME] makes it possible, for example, to use certain accented characters in a domain name when the extension concerned accepts them.
Subdomain
A subdomain makes it possible to create a separate address from the same domain name.
For example, with the domain:
monsite.fr
you can create:
blog.monsite.fr
or:
boutique.monsite.fr
A subdomain can display a different website or be used for a specific service.

Understanding DNS
DNS
DNS, for Domain Name System, is the system that makes it possible in particular to connect a domain name to the servers used by a website, e-mails or other services.
For example, when a user enters monsite.fr, DNS makes it possible to determine which server the request should be sent to.
DNS servers
DNS servers indicate where the DNS configuration of a domain is managed.
When you use [ADDRESS] DNS servers, [ADDRESS] DNS zone of the domain is generally managed from the relevant LWS services.
Changing DNS servers and modifying a DNS zone are two different operations.
DNS zone
The DNS zone contains the various records that make it possible to direct the services associated with your domain.
It can in particular indicate:
- which server your website should point to;
- which servers should receive your e-mails;
- how certain external services should verify your domain.
A record
An A record links a domain name or subdomain to an IPv4 address.
For example, it can indicate which IP address monsite.fr should be directed to.
AAAA record
An AAAA record works like an A record, but it uses an IPv6 address.
CNAME record
A CNAME record makes it possible to map one name to another host name.
It is often used for subdomains or to connect a domain to certain external services.
MX record
An MX record indicates which servers are responsible for receiving a domain's e-mails.
An incorrect modification of MX records can prevent messages from being received.
TXT record
A TXT record makes it possible to publish textual information in the DNS zone.
It is notably used to:
- verify ownership of a domain with an external service;
- configure SPF;
- configure certain security mechanisms related to e-mails.
[PERSON_NAME], DKIM and DMARC
SPF
SPF makes it possible to indicate which servers are authorized to send e-mails on behalf of your domain.
The SPF policy is generally published in a DNS record of type TXT.
Proper SPF configuration helps limit spoofing of your sending address.
DKIM
DKIM adds a digital signature to sent e-mails.
This signature allows the receiving server to verify that the message really comes from an authorized server and that it has not been modified during transit.
DMARC
DMARC complements SPF and DKIM.
It makes it possible in particular for a domain owner to indicate to receiving servers how to handle messages that do not pass authentication checks correctly.
Who is involved in managing a domain name?
[ADDRESS] of the domain
The holder, [PERSON_NAME]em>registrant, is the person or organization in whose name the domain is registered.
It is important that their information is accurate and up to date.
Owner contact
The owner contact corresponds to the information of the [ADDRESS]>
Certain important changes may require validation from this contact.
Technical contact
The technical contact may be responsible for managing the technical aspects of the domain.
Depending on the service configuration, it may be different from the holder.
Registrar or registration office
The registrar, also called the registration office, is the provider with whom you register and manage your domain name.
LWS acts as the office [PERSON_NAME] extensions that it offers directly or through its partners.
Registry
The registry is the organization responsible for managing a domain name extension.
It defines in particular certain rules applicable to domain names using this extension.
The rules can therefore be different between a domain in .fr, .com, .eu or another extension.
[PERSON_NAME] and domain life cycle
Auth code, AuthInfo or EPP code
The Auth code, sometimes called AuthInfo, transfer code or EPP code, is a code used to authorize the transfer of a domain name to another registrar.
Not all extensions necessarily use the same procedure.
This code must be kept confidential: anyone who has it can attempt to initiate a transfer of the domain.
[PERSON_NAME] domain
A transfer consists of moving the management of a domain name from one registrar to another.
A transfer does not correspond to a change of owner.
In many cases, the website and e-mail addresses can continue to function during the transfer if their DNS configuration remains unchanged.
Change of ownership
A change of ownership consists of modifying the holder of the domain.
This operation is different from a transfer to another provider.
Depending on the extension concerned, validations or special conditions may be requested.
Expiration
A domain name is registered for a specified period and must be renewed.
When it reaches expiration, the services associated with the domain may be interrupted.
It is therefore recommended to renew the domain before its expiration date.
Redemption period
After expiration and depending on the extension used, a domain may enter a redemption period.
[PERSON_NAME], the domain is generally no longer usable normally but can sometimes still be restored.
Restoring a domain during the redemption period may incur additional fees. [PERSON_NAME] depend on the extension concerned.
HOLD status
A domain placed in HOLD status may no longer be published normally in DNS.
This may in particular prevent access to the website or the functioning of the associated e-mail addresses.
The reason for the status must be checked before making any change.
Registration data, [ADDRESS] and WHOIS
Registration data makes it possible to obtain certain technical or administrative information about a domain name, [PERSON_NAME] :
- its registrar;
- its registration and expiration dates;
- its DNS servers;
- certain statuses associated with the domain.
The term WHOIS is historically used to refer to the services that make it possible to consult this information.
For generic extensions, the RDAP protocol is now used as the reference system for consulting registration data.
The personal contact details of a domain holder are not necessarily public. Depending on the extension, the registry and the type of holder, certain information may be hidden to protect personal data.
Frequently asked questions
What is the difference between a domain name and hosting?
The domain name is the address used to access your site, for example monsite.fr.
Hosting refers to the space where the files, databases and other elements necessary for the site to function are stored.
You can therefore own a domain name without hosting, or point your domain to hosting located with another provider.
What is the difference between DNS servers and the DNS zone?
DNS servers indicate where the DNS configuration of the domain is managed.
The DNS zone contains the records that actually direct the website, e-mails and other services.
You can therefore change a record in your DNS zone without changing the domain's DNS servers.
What is the difference between transferring a domain and changing its owner?
A transfer changes the registrar responsible for managing the domain.
A change of ownership modifies the domain's holder.
These are two separate operations.

How long does it take for a DNS change to become visible?
A DNS change is not always visible immediately.
Old information may [PERSON_NAME] DNS caches. The delay depends in particular on the type of change and the values configured in the DNS zone.
It is therefore normal for a change to work quickly from some networks but not yet from others.
Are a web redirect and a DNS pointing the same thing?
No.
A DNS pointing indicates which server or service a domain should be directed to.
A web redirect sends the visitor from one web address to another, for example from ancien-site.fr to nouveau-site.fr.
These two mechanisms do not meet the same need.
